Why You Should Use a VPN for Cryptocurrency Security

In the rapidly evolving world of cryptocurrency, security is paramount. One effective way to enhance your online security while trading or investing in cryptocurrencies is by using a Virtual Private Network (VPN). Here are several compelling reasons why incorporating a VPN into your cryptocurrency activities is essential for safeguarding your assets.


1. Enhanced Privacy

A VPN masks your IP address, making your online activities more difficult to trace. This is particularly important in the cryptocurrency realm, where privacy is a key concern. By encrypting your internet connection, a VPN keeps your trades and personal information away from prying eyes, ensuring that your identity remains confidential.


2. Protection from Hackers

Cryptocurrency exchanges are frequent targets for hackers. When using public Wi-Fi or unsecured networks, your data can be at risk of interception. A VPN encrypts your connection, creating a secure tunnel for your data and significantly reducing the risk of being hacked while conducting cryptocurrency transactions.


3. Bypassing Geo-Restrictions

In some regions, access to cryptocurrency exchanges or specific coins may be restricted. A VPN allows you to change your virtual location, enabling you to bypass these restrictions and access all available platforms. This flexibility empowers you to trade freely, regardless of your geographical location.


4. Avoiding ISP Throttling

Some Internet Service Providers (ISPs) may throttle your internet speed when they detect cryptocurrency-related traffic. This can lead to slower load times and poor trading experiences. By using a VPN, you can obscure your traffic, reducing the likelihood of your ISP interfering with your connection and ensuring a more reliable trading experience.


5. Increased Security on Mobile Devices

Many cryptocurrency enthusiasts use mobile devices for trading. However, mobile networks can be less secure than traditional connections. A VPN on your mobile device ensures that your transactions and data are secure, protecting you from potential cyber threats when you're on the go.


6. Anonymity in Transactions

While the blockchain is inherently transparent, adding an extra layer of anonymity through a VPN can be beneficial. It helps protect your identity and transaction details from being linked back to you, which can be crucial for those who prioritize a high level of privacy.
